如何在Word文檔中將數字轉換為單詞?
本文討論的是在Word文檔中將數字轉換為英語單詞的方法,如果您感興趣,請繼續查看詳細信息。
使用Kutools for Excel在Excel中將數字轉換為英文單詞
使用VBA將數字轉換為英文單詞
1.選擇要轉換成單詞的數字,按 Alt + F11鍵 打開鑰匙 Microsoft Visual Basic for Applications 窗口。
2。 點擊 插入 > 模塊,然後復制以下代碼並將其粘貼到 模塊 腳本。
VBA:將數字轉換為單詞
Sub ConvertNumberToWord()
'UpdatebyExtendoffice20181010
Dim xDigit As Double
Dim xBuff As String
On Error Resume Next
Selection.MoveLeft wdWord, 1, wdMove
Selection.MoveRight wdWord, 1, wdExtend
xDigit = Val(Trim(Selection.Text))
If xDigit = 0 And Str(xDigit) <> Trim(Selection.Text) Then Exit Sub
If xDigit > 999999 Then
If xDigit <= 999999999 Then
xBuff = Trim(Int(Str(xDigit / 1000000)))
Selection.Fields.Add Selection.Range, wdFieldEmpty, "= " + xBuff + " \* CardText", True
Selection.MoveLeft wdWord, 1, wdExtend
xBuff = Selection.Text & " million "
xDigit = Right(Str(xDigit), 6)
End If
End If
If xDigit <= 999999 Then
Selection.Fields.Add Selection.Range, wdFieldEmpty, "= " + Str(xDigit) + " \* CardText", True
Selection.MoveLeft wdWord, 1, wdExtend
xDigit = xBuff & Selection.Text
Selection.TypeText xDigit + " "
Else
MsgBox "Number too large", vbOKOnly, "Kutool for Word"
End If
End Sub
3。 按 F5 鍵來運行代碼,現在數字已轉換為單詞。
備註:該代碼每次僅適用於一個號碼。
使用Kutools for Excel將數字轉換為英文單詞
如果您想將數字轉換為Excel工作表中的單詞,則有一個方便的工具- 數字到單詞 Kutools for Excel,可以將數字轉換為英語或中文單詞,或將數字轉換為英語或中文貨幣。
後 免費安裝 Kutools for Excel,請執行以下操作:
1.選擇您想要將數字轉換為單詞的單元格,然後單擊 庫工具 > 內容 > 數字到單詞.
2.在彈出的對話框中,選中 English 不轉換為貨幣 選項。
3。 點擊 Ok or 申請,所選數字將轉換為單詞。
最佳辦公生產力工具
Kutools for Word - 透過 Over 提升您的文字體驗 100 顯著特點!
🤖 Kutools人工智慧功能: 生成內容 / 重寫文字 / 文件問答 / 獲得快速解答 / 翻譯文件 / 波蘭語文檔(保留格式)...
📘 文件掌握: 分頁 / 合併文件 / 以各種格式匯出選擇(PDF/TXT/DOC/HTML...) / 批次轉換為PDF...
✏ 內容編輯: 跨多個文件批量查找和替換 / 調整所有圖片的大小 / 轉置表行和列 / 將表格轉換為文字...
🧹 輕鬆清潔: 移開 多餘的空間 / 分節符 / 文本框 / 超鏈接 / 如需更多拆卸工具,請前往 移除 團體...
➕ 創意插入: 插入 千位分隔符 / 複選框 / 單選按鈕 / QR Code / 條碼 / 多張圖片 / 發現更多 插入 團體...
🔍 精準選擇:精確定位 特定頁面 / 檯 / 形狀 / 標題段落 / 增強導航功能 更多 選擇 功能...
⭐ 星級增強: 導航到任何位置 / 自動插入重複文字 / 在文檔視窗之間切換 / 11 轉化 工具...